What Most Buyers Get Wrong

Frothing System: LatteGo vs. Classic

When choosing an automatic cappuccino maker, the milk frothing system is key. Philips offers two main options: LatteGo and their classic milk system. LatteGo, found on models like the 5500 and 4400 Series, is designed for simplicity with fewer parts and is easier to clean.

The classic system, seen in the 3300 and 1200 Series, requires manual assembly and cleaning but offers traditional steam frothing for those who prefer a hands-on approach.

Built-in Grinder Precision Matters

The quality of your cappuccino hinges on the freshness of the beans. Opt for machines with integrated grinders, such as the De’Longhi Rivelia, to ensure optimal flavor. A grinder allows you to use whole beans, preserving their aroma and taste until the moment of brewing.

While some models offer multiple grind settings, consider how much control you want over the coarseness, as this directly impacts the espresso extraction and overall cup quality.

The Preset Pitfall of Best Automatic Cappuccino Maker

When evaluating machines, the number of pre-programmed drink options is a misleading metric; the true differentiator lies in the milk system’s design and ease of cleaning.

Consider the Philips 4400 Series Fully Automatic Espresso Machine, LatteGo Milk System, with its 12 presets, versus the Philips 3200 Series Fully Automatic Espresso Machine, LatteGo Milk Frother, offering 5 aromatic coffees. While the 4400 boasts more options, both utilize the LatteGo system. This two-part, spout-free container is a game-changer, eliminating tubes and hidden crevices that harbor milk residue.

Cleaning is reduced to a mere rinse under the tap, a stark contrast to machines with integrated milk carafes or complex frothing wands that demand detailed disassembly and scrubbing. The Philips 1200 Series Fully Automatic Espresso Machine, Classic Milk Frother, exemplifies this older, more cumbersome approach, requiring conscious effort to maintain hygiene beyond a quick wipe.

What to Look For in a Best Automatic Cappuccino Maker

Milk frothing systems

For milk frothing, prioritize integrated wands if you value speed and a compact footprint that requires minimal setup. These are ideal for quick espresso-based drinks. Opt for separate milk carafes when you desire precise control over froth texture, often offering multiple settings for microfoam to dense foam, catering to specific drink profiles.

If you frequently enjoy varied milk-based coffees and appreciate nuanced textures, choose a machine with dedicated froth consistency settings, signaling superior milk texturing capability for a richer experience.

Brewing customization options

When seeking brewing customization, consider models with a generous coffee bean capacity and a substantial water tank; these reduce refueling frequency and are best for households with high coffee consumption. Look for adjustable brew strength for personalized taste, and a broader drink menu that includes espresso, latte, and macchiato options if you enjoy variety without manual intervention. For users who demand flexibility and wish to tailor each cup, select a machine offering multiple levels of brew strength and a diverse pre-programmed drink selection.

Ease of use maintenance

For effortless operation, prioritize one-touch functionality and automatic cleaning cycles; these significantly reduce your daily effort. A removable brew group is a key indicator of user-friendly maintenance, allowing for thorough rinsing. Any components explicitly stated as dishwasher-safe further simplify cleaning.

If your primary concern is minimizing your involvement in upkeep, choose a unit featuring one-touch brewing and comprehensive automatic cleaning programs, ensuring consistent performance with the least amount of user intervention.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Does An Automatic Cappuccino Maker Froth Milk?

An automatic cappuccino maker typically uses an integrated steam wand or a separate carafe system to create milk foam. Hot steam is injected into the milk, creating tiny bubbles that form a light, airy, or dense foam depending on the machine’s setting.

Can I Use Any Type Of Milk With An Automatic Cappuccino Maker?

Most automatic cappuccino makers work well with dairy milk, offering rich foam. Many can also froth plant-based alternatives like oat or almond milk, though the texture and stability of the foam may vary compared to dairy.

What Is The Difference Between A Semi-Automatic And An Automatic Cappuccino Maker?

Semi-automatic machines require user input for grinding and tamping, but control the brewing process. Automatic cappuccino makers handle the entire brewing process from grinding to frothing, often with one-touch controls for various drinks.

How Often Do I Need To Clean An Automatic Cappuccino Maker?

Regular cleaning is essential for optimal performance. Most machines have automated cleaning cycles for the milk system, and the brew group typically requires weekly rinsing. Descaling should be done based on usage and water hardness.
